To connect a controller to your PC, follow these steps: 1. Wired: Plug the USB end of your controller into an available USB port on your PC. Your system should automatically detect and install necessary drivers. 2. Wireless: For Bluetooth controllers, press the pairing button on the controller and navigate to Bluetooth settings on your PC to complete the pairing process. Tip: Ensure your PC supports Bluetooth for wireless connections.
FAQs & Answers
- Can I use any controller with my PC? Most USB and Bluetooth controllers are compatible with PCs, but some may require additional drivers or software for full functionality.
- How do I connect a Bluetooth controller to a Windows PC? Put your controller in pairing mode, then go to your PC’s Bluetooth settings to find and connect the controller.
- Why doesn’t my PC recognize my wired controller? Ensure the USB cable is properly connected and the drivers install automatically; try another USB port or update drivers if needed.
